INTRODUCTION: The Evolution of Open Data -- CHAPTER 1: Looking Back Toward a "Smarter" Open Data Future -- CHAPTER 2: Open Government Data and Confidential Commercial Information: Challenging the Future of Open Data -- CHAPTER 3: Reusability of Publicly Accessible User Data on Platform Websites -- CHAPTER 4: Challenges to the Access of Government Open Data by Private Sector Companies -- CHAPTER 5: Open Data and Government Liability -- CHAPTER 6: Examining the Value of Geospatial Open Data -- CHAPTER 7: Data for Development: Exploring Connections Between Open Data, Big Data, and Data Privacy in the Global South -- CHAPTER 8: The Future of Open Data Is Rural -- CHAPTER 9: Reflections on the Future of Open Data.
Governments have committed to open data at a time when the digital economy is transforming the value of data. Technology also expands the nature and volume of data collected by governments, altering the significance of open government data and rendering its practice more complex. In this evolving context, this book explores the future of open data.
